Glazed Roasted Pork with Tender Interior: A Perfectly Roasted Pork with a Sweet and Savory Glaze

Preheat the Oven: Preheat your oven to 350°F (175°C) and line a roasting pan with parchment paper or lightly grease it.
Prepare the Pork: Pat the pork shoulder or ham dry with paper towels. Rub the entire surface with olive oil, then season generously with salt and pepper. Sprinkle the minced garlic, fresh thyme, and rosemary over the pork, pressing gently to adhere.
Roast the Pork: Place the pork in the prepared roasting pan and roast for about 2.5 to 3 hours (or longer for a bone-in cut), or until the internal temperature reaches 190°F (88°C) for the perfect tender interior. If you’re using a boneless cut, it will cook a bit quicker, so start checking the temperature around 2 hours.
Make the Glaze: While the pork is roasting, combine the brown sugar, Dijon mustard, apple cider vinegar, soy sauce, cinnamon, and ground cloves in a small saucepan. Bring to a simmer over medium heat, stirring occasionally. Once the glaze thickens and becomes syrupy (about 5-7 minutes), remove from heat and set aside.
Glaze the Pork: About 20 minutes before the pork is done, brush a generous amount of the glaze over the pork. Continue roasting, basting the pork with the glaze every 5-10 minutes, until the exterior is golden and caramelized.
Rest the Pork: Once the pork is done, remove it from the oven and let it rest for 10-15 minutes before slicing. This will allow the juices to redistribute for a moist, tender roast.
Serve: Slice the pork and serve it with the remaining glaze on the side. Enjoy with roasted vegetables or mashed potatoes for a complete meal!
